Overview

Local governance brings democracy closer to people through Panchayats and Municipalities, enabling decentralised planning and service delivery.

Articles / Provisions

Key constitutional references

  • Part IX
  • Part IXA
  • Articles 243 to 243ZG

Core Notes

Key points

  • The 73rd Amendment deals with Panchayats.
  • The 74th Amendment deals with Municipalities.
  • Local bodies strengthen participatory democracy.
  • Devolution of functions, funds and functionaries remains a major challenge.

Prelims Focus

Prelims pointers

  • 73rd and 74th Amendments were enacted in 1992.
  • The Eleventh Schedule is related to Panchayats.
  • The Twelfth Schedule is related to Municipalities.
